#75A39C Color
#75A39C is rgb(117, 163, 156) in RGB, hsl(171, 20%, 55%) in HSL, and about cmyk(28%, 0%, 4%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Green Sheen (#6EAEA1),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.27.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#75A39C Channel Values
How #75A39C bre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 117 · G 163 · B 156 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 171° · S 20% · L 55%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 171° · S 28%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 28% · M 0% · Y 4%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.81:1 vs white · 7.48: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#75A39C background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#75A39C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#75A39C?
#75A39C is a mid-tone teal — rgb(117, 163, 156) in RGB and hsl(171, 20%, 55%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Green Sheen (#6EAEA1),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.27.
What is the RGB value of #75A39C?
#75A39C is rgb(117, 163, 156) — red 117, green 163, and blue 156 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#75A39C?
#75A39C converts to approximately cmyk(28%, 0%, 4%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#75A39C be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#75A39C scores 2.81:1 against white and 7.48: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#75A39C as a CSS color keyword?
No. #75A39C is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is cadetblue (#5F9EA0) at a CIE76 distance of 7.55,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
